Race 1: staying out of the baby race
Race 2: I like Silent Move and Zaafiel. Silent move ran in a strong race 2 races ago and wasn't disgraced. Zaafiel has the best time of this bunch.
Race 3: I like Sparkler. The Cape form behind Abington and Mainspring (who i think have both already franked the form) looks too strong for this bunch.
Race 4: My first choice here would be Slumdog Oscar. He led and only tired late last time. I think the shorter trip will suit him down to the ground. Perhaps cover with Khight of Darkness and French Pearl.
Race 5: I like Social Master, but will cover with King of Eagles, Youth Club (both a turnaround in weights with Social Master) and Wildhay (nice light weight and back to a more suitable distance)
Race 6: Difficult race, but i am going with Babel(good run behind Castlethorpe), Happy Ending, Count Oliver (eyecatching last run)
Race 7: Newturf is very confident, so i am going with Classic Lecture. I also think that last run was 2nd run after a rest and it might have been a flat run. He really is better than that last run.
Race 8: I am going with Al Caruso (very consistent), Romero (here the Abington form is coming to the fore again, coupled with the fact that the race was run in a very fast time) and Tara's Kingdom (2.5kg' better off than Al Caruso....so he must go in for me)

Guys I notice a few tips out for Golden Lucci.
I can't have him for 2 reasons.
1. When he comes under pressure, he starts to hang like a drunken sailor.
2. I think he is best over 1000m
I know he beat Classic Lecture, but I think Classic ran way below his best. He was sweating profusely that day and it was his 2nd run after a long rest. I expect him to be lengths better today.
